Funneman joins PBUC in full-time role 12/05/2012 6:27 PM ET
Minor League Baseball
NASHVILLE, Tenn. -- Minor League Baseball announced today that Tyler Funneman, who joined Professional Baseball Umpire Corp. (PBUC) on a part-time basis in June, is now a full-time field evaluator/instructor. Funneman will observe, instruct and evaluate Minor League Baseball umpires throughout the 16 domestic-based leagues. "Tyler has proven to be a valuable member of our staff in the short time that he has been with us and has earned the opportunity to work with our umpires on a full-time basis," said Justin Klemm, executive director of PBUC. The Grays Lake, Ill., resident umpired in the New York-Penn, Midwest, Florida State, Texas, Pacific Coast and Venezuela Winter Leagues. Funneman also earned invitations from Major League Baseball to work in the Arizona Fall League and Major League Spring Training. |
